The Impact of Teaming Up with Established Artists

Key Glock made waves when he collaborated with fellow Memphis rapper Young Dolph on the joint project "Dum and Dummer." This album not only highlighted their chemistry but also introduced Key Glock to a broader audience. With tracks like "1st Day Out," listeners got to experience a fusion of their distinct styles. Young Dolph’s seasoned presence complemented Key Glock’s youthful energy, creating a perfect balance that captivated fans. Their collaboration served as a benchmark, showcasing how well their lyrical approaches could mesh together to paint vivid stories of their lives and experiences.
